What problem does it solve?

This skill addresses the common pitfall of blind spots in project planning and design by forcing a rigorous, systematic review of every decision and dependency.

Core Features & Use Cases

  • Systematic Interrogation: Breaks down complex plans into individual components to ensure no detail is overlooked.
  • Dependency Resolution: Identifies and resolves conflicts between design choices before implementation begins.
  • Use Case: Use this when you have a draft architecture or a new project proposal and want to ensure it is robust enough to withstand real-world constraints.
